How Do I Find a Good General Contractor?

Finding a good general contractor involves more than just a quick online search. Here are some critical steps you should follow:

Ask for Recommendations: Start by asking friends, family, or neighbors who have recently completed similar projects. Check Online Reviews: Websites like Angie's List or Yelp can provide insights into various contractors' reputations. Verify Credentials: Ensure that the contractor holds valid licenses and certifications required in California. Interview Multiple Contractors: Speak with at least three contractors to compare their approaches and pricing. Visit Past Projects: If possible, visit some completed projects to assess the quality of work.

By following these steps, you'll narrow down your options and find top-rated general contractors a trustworthy partner for your project.

How Much Does a General Contractor Charge?

General contractors typically charge in different ways depending on the project's scope:

    Percentage of Total Costs: Many contractors charge between 10% to 20% of the total project cost. Flat Fee: For smaller projects, some may offer a fixed rate. Hourly Rate: Occasionally used for consultation or small jobs; rates often range from $50 to $150 per hour.

It's vital to obtain detailed quotes from multiple contractors to understand what you're paying for.

How Long Does a General Contractor Take to Complete a Project?

The timeline for completing a project varies based on several factors such as project size and complexity:

    Small Projects: A simple kitchen remodel could take 4-6 weeks. Medium Projects: A bathroom renovation might take 6-8 weeks. Large Projects: Custom home builds typically require several months up to over a year depending on design intricacies.

Do I Need a License to Be a General Contractor?

Yes! In California, it is mandatory for general contractors to possess a valid license issued by the Contractors State License Board (CSLB). This ensures they meet specific standards regarding skill level and financial responsibility.

What Is the Difference Between a General Contractor and a Builder?

While many use "general contractor" and "builder" interchangeably, there are differences:

    A general contractor manages entire projects from start to finish while hiring subcontractors (like electricians or plumbers). A builder may focus specifically on constructing homes but may not handle overall project management tasks.

Understanding these roles helps clarify expectations regarding responsibilities throughout your construction journey.

How Do I Verify a General Contractor's Credentials?

To verify credentials effectively:

Visit the CSLB website. Check if their license is current and valid. Look up any complaints or disciplinary actions against them. Request proof of insurance coverage.

This diligence protects you from unlicensed or irresponsible contractors.

What Insurance Should a General Contractor Have?

A reputable general contractor should carry several types of insurance:

Liability Insurance: Protects against damages during construction. Workers' Compensation: Covers injuries sustained by workers on-site. Builder's Risk Insurance: Specifically covers homes under construction against damage or loss.

Always request proof of insurance before hiring any contractor.

What Are The Payment Structures Used By Contractors?

Payment structures may vary but often include one (or more) methods outlined below:

1 . Upfront Deposit: To secure services before beginning work (typically 10%-30%).

2 . Progress Payments: Based upon milestones achieved throughout phases executed during build-out process - ensuring accountability!

3 . Final Payment: Due upon satisfactory completion ensuring everything meets agreed-upon standards set forth initially per contract signed pre-construction commencement started!
